Tips
Payment
Cash is required for Goshuin (stamps) and Gokito (prayers).
English Support
English guidance is limited.
Reservations
Advanced booking is required for certain prayers (e.g., Shunkoshiki).
Clothing
Modest and respectful attire is recommended.
Photography
Please follow all rules regarding photography in sacred areas.
Accessibility
Some areas feature stone paths and steps.
Etiquette
Please maintain a quiet and respectful demeanor at this sacred site.
